Mr Briton* had been working as a plumber since the age of 16, and had taken out a Westpac Term Life policy with a total and permanent disablement option benefit. He is married with children.
In February 2000, Mr Briton developed osteoarthritis causing severe pain in both hips, as well as in the lower back. This pain became unbearable and by September of that year, he could no longer continue work.
At the age of 44, his doctor told him that he needed both hip joints replaced, and would never be able to work as a plumber again, or any other job for which his skills were suitable for.
After the six-month qualifying period, Mr Briton was paid the full total and permanent disability benefit of $450,000.
